Arezou
/AA-R-EH-HH-Z-UW/
Wish, desire, aspiration — from Persian ārezū, ‘longing, heartfelt wish,’ traced to Avestan harezu, ‘desire.’ A hopeful, lyrical Persian feminine name carrying the pull of what the heart wants.
